Abstract: The spatially close and highly reactive ester appendages through the opening of A and B rings of prieurianin-type limonoids would further rearrange into diverse ring system via oxygen-bridges or new C–C bonds. In our current research, two limonoids with an unprecedented 7/6/5 tricyclic skeleton (1) and 2,6-dioxabicyclo[3.2.2]nonan-3-one caged ring A system (2), along with eight other new ones (3–10) were obtained from Aphanamixis polystachya and Aphanamixis sinensis, and the structure of 1 was confirmed by X-ray crystallographic diffraction. Meanwhile, a reliable solution based on biomimetic alkaline hydrolysis to build new oxygen-bridges via OH-1 was established to resolve the difficulties in the structural elucidation of prieurianin limonoids with broad or missing NMR signals and applied for the determination of 9 and 10. Moreover, the potential of Dieckmann reaction as a key biosynthetic step in the formation of C-3/C-6 bonds in the aphanamolide-type backbone was verified by chemical conversions of 13–16. These findings provided new ideas and perspectives for structural elucidation and chemical communication of prieurianin-type limonoids.

Abstract: The floral anatomy ofSwietenia mahogoni Jacq.,Soymida febrifuga Juss.,Chukrassia valutino A. Juss.,Dysoxylum binectariferum Hook.,Aphanamixis rohituka W. & A. andHeynea trijuga Roxb. are discussed. Calyx is supplied by two whorls of traces inSwietenia, Aphanamixis, Chukrassia andHeynea and only one whorl of traces inSoymida andDysoxylum. In all the species, exceptHeynea, petals receive their supply independently. InHeynea petals receive their supply from compound strands. Staminal tube receives its supply from compound strands inSwietenia,Chukrassia, Heynea, Aphanamixis and from independent strands inSoymida andDysoxylum. Anthers are syngenesious inDysoxylum.

Abstract: The invention discloses 5 -lipoxygenase inhibitory product prepared from botanical sources. More specifically, the invention describes 5 -lipoxygenase inhibitory extracts or bio-enriched extracts or fractions of Aphanamixis polystachya, methods of making 5 -lipoxygenase inhibitory extract, and methods of treating and/or preventing disease conditions mediated by 5 -lipoxygenase by using the said extract. The invention further discloses pharmaceutical or nutraceutical or dietary compositions containing therapeutically effective amounts of the extracts of Aphanamixis polystachya in combination with other known anti-inflammatory agents useful for oral, parenteral and topical administration.

Abstract: Anatomy of the rachis, petiole and petiolule in 15 species distributed over 13 genera of Meliaceae is investigated. The mechanical tissues in these organs are invariably sclerenchymatous and rarely collenchymatous. Vascular tissue in the form of distinct bundles, an arc-shaped strand or a continuous cylinder is noted in different organs. Medullary bundles occur in Walsura and Aglaia, while cortical bundles are present in Aphanamixis and Khaya. Both the types are seen in Soymida. A key based on the anatomical characters of the leaf stalk is provided for the delineation of the taxa studied.
